The Deer Park Dance Program offers a structured and varied curriculum designed to accommodate a wide age range and diverse interests in dance. Their services are aimed at providing comprehensive dance education in a community setting. Here are some of the key services and classes offered:

  • Classes for Various Age Groups:
    • Tiny Tots (Ages 3-5/Kindergarten): Specifically for young children who are potty-trained, introducing them to fundamental movement and rhythm.
    • Kindergarten: Classes focusing on Ballet and Flag (likely referring to color guard/dance with flags).
    • 1st Grade & Up: Hip Hop.
    • 2nd Grade & Up: Clogging.
    • 3rd Grade & Up: Pom, Jazz.
    • 4th Grade & Up: Kick.
    • 9th Grade & Up: Lyrical (with instructor approval and recent ballet experience).
    • Pointe: Instructor Approval Only (indicating advanced ballet training).
    • Adult Classes: The program also offers classes for adults, extending the opportunity for dance to all ages.
  • Diverse Dance Disciplines: The program covers a wide range of styles, including Ballet, Clogging, Flag, Hip Hop, Jazz, Lyrical/Contemporary, Pointe, Pom, and Tiny Tots. This variety allows students to explore different forms of dance.
  • Skill-Level Accommodation: Classes are designed to accommodate all skill levels, from beginners to more experienced dancers, with variations based on experience.
  • Annual Spring Recital: All students are invited to participate in the Spring Recital held in May, providing a valuable performance opportunity and a chance to showcase their progress.
  • Volunteer-Led Operation: The Deer Park Dance Program is a volunteer-led dance studio, with board members dedicating their time outside of full-time obligations to manage and run the program, indicating a strong community commitment.
  • Focus on Individual Needs: The program aims to provide a "first-class education to ALL students," appreciating and diligently working to support the diverse needs of each and every student.
  • Flexible Scheduling: While classes are limited by size and available on a first-come, first-served basis, the program is mindful that scheduling changes can occur due to class sizes and conflicts.
  • Affordable Fees: Based on historical data, the program appears to maintain reasonable registration and monthly fees, making dance accessible to a broader segment of the community.
